Jhenaidah BCL activists help farmers by harvesting paddy


Published : 03 May 2021 09:22 PM

The activists of Bangladesh Chhatra League (BCL) in Jhenaidah have harvested the ripen paddy of a poor farmer in Sadar upazila. The BCL men harvested the paddy from the plot of Akkas Ali at Muraridah village in Jhenaidah Sadar upazila on Sunday morning continued till noon. The paddy was harvested maintaining social distancing.

BCL Jhenaidah district unit president Rana Hamid and general secretary Abdul Awal led the team where a total of 23 activists participated. 

When contacted, Rana Hamid said they came to know that farmer Akkas Ali was in trouble when his paddy was lying ripen in the fields for harvesting. 

As per the direction of the Prime Minster, also ruling Awami League chief Sheikh Hasina, they rushed to spot and harvested the paddy from two bighas of land united. 

The BCL men said they were very glad to stand by the poor farmer when he was not in a position to harvest ripen paddy from his plot for want of money.

Farmer Akkas Ali when contacted said he was very impressed when the BCL men had furnished the ripen Boro harvesting paddy from two bighas of land very fast. It had saved his money and protected the crop from probable damaged by rain or storm any time. This sort of activities by the students’ fronts might help lot for the poor and needy farmers when they need, Akkas Ali said.
